Safety and security window film is designed to help hold glass fragments in place after a sheet of glass has broken. Solar and energy-saving films are manufactured to be energy-efficient and reduce heat and light transfer.

It is important for consumers to understand that while any film on glass adds a certain default level of safety, there is no intended safety or security benefit unless the product is tested and listed as such by the manufacturer.

In order to avoid buying the incorrect product it is important that the consumer asks to see the company's literature – because this has to state the specific benefits of each particular product.

There have been incidences in the past of DIY lifestyle magazines advising people to save money by trying at-home methods in order to keep their houses cool in summer and warm in winter. A lot of misleading, and sometimes incorrect, information has been given about the advantages and disadvantages of window film, solar film, safety film and car window tinting.

In addition, what’s important to know is that there is a lot of risk involved in using an unaccredited window film supplier and fitter. Not only may the product not do what it is supposed to do but chances are, with incorrect application, the film will soon start to crack and peel and may even permanently damage or destroy the look of the glass.
